This document summarizes a study that investigated relationships between video game consumption, esports spectating, and different forms of gambling. The study found that while video games can involve wagering with uncertain outcomes like gambling, modern video games themselves do not generally act as a pathway to problematic gambling. Higher rates of problematic gaming were not strongly associated with higher rates of gambling activity or problematic gambling. However, the finding that problem gaming and gambling are fundamentally connected was questioned. A limitation was the study's lack of diversity among respondents.
